Baked Fruit Slice


Ingredients:
1 cup self-raising flour
1/2 cup plain flour
1/2 cup custard powder
2 tablespoons icing sugar
125g butter, cubed, chilled
1 egg
2 tablespoons iced water
425g canned pie apple (see variation)
1 cup fruit medley or mixed fruit
1 teaspoon mixed spice
icing sugar, for dusting
Directions:
Preheat oven to 180°C. Line a baking tray with baking paper.
Combine flours, custard powder and icing sugar in a food processor. Process for 20 seconds until well combined. Add butter and process until mixture resembles fine breadcrumbs. Add egg and water. Process until mixture comes together in a ball.
Remove dough from food processor. Knead gently until smooth. Cut in half. Flatten each half into a 2cm-thick disc. Wrap in greaseproof paper. Place in fridge to rest for 20 minutes.
Roll each piece of pastry out into a 26cm square. Place 1 piece onto prepared tray.
Combine pie apple, fruit medley and mixed spice. Spoon over pastry, leaving a 1cm border. Place second square of pastry on top. Press edges together.
Bake for 40 to 45 minutes or until pastry is firm and light golden. Cool for 10 minutes before cutting into squares. Dust with icing sugar. Serve with clotted cream or ice-cream, if desired.
Notes & tips

Variation:
Canned pie apricot may be used in place of canned pie apple
